#f4655f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#f4655f is composed of 95.7% red, 39.6%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.6%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 2.4 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 66.5%. #f4655f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cabe with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

● #f4655f color description : Soft red.
The hexadecimal color #f4655f has RGB values of R:244, G:101,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.61,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16016735.
